当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储服务采用的存储机制是什么类型,深入解析对象存储服务,存储机制及其工作原理

对象存储服务采用的存储机制是什么类型,深入解析对象存储服务,存储机制及其工作原理

对象存储服务采用的存储机制为键值对存储,即通过唯一的键来定位和访问存储对象。该服务将数据以对象的形式存储,每个对象包含数据本身、元数据以及对象唯一标识符。工作原理是:客...

对象存储服务采用的存储机制为键值对存储,即通过唯一的键来定位和访问存储对象。该服务将数据以对象的形式存储,每个对象包含数据本身、元数据以及对象唯一标识符。工作原理是:客户端上传对象时,服务器分配唯一的对象标识符,将对象数据存储在分布式存储系统中,并通过网络进行访问。

随着互联网技术的飞速发展,数据量呈爆炸式增长,如何高效、安全地存储海量数据成为各大企业关注的焦点,对象存储服务(Object Storage Service,OSS)作为一种新兴的存储技术,因其具有高扩展性、低成本、易于使用等特点,逐渐成为企业数据存储的首选,本文将深入解析对象存储服务的存储机制,帮助读者了解其工作原理和优势。

对象存储服务概述

1、定义

对象存储服务是一种基于对象模型的存储技术,将数据存储为一个个独立的对象,每个对象由唯一标识符、数据内容和元数据三部分组成,与传统的块存储和文件存储相比,对象存储具有以下特点:

(1)数据粒度小:以单个对象为单位存储数据,便于管理和访问。

(2)高扩展性:支持水平扩展,可满足海量数据存储需求。

对象存储服务采用的存储机制是什么类型,深入解析对象存储服务,存储机制及其工作原理

(3)低成本:采用分布式存储架构,降低存储成本。

(4)易于使用:提供简单的API接口,方便用户操作。

2、应用场景

对象存储服务广泛应用于以下场景:

(1)云存储:为用户提供海量数据存储空间。

(2)大数据:存储和分析海量数据。

(3)视频监控:存储监控视频数据。

(4)游戏行业:存储游戏数据。

对象存储服务存储机制

1、分布式存储架构

对象存储服务采用分布式存储架构,将数据分散存储在多个节点上,提高数据可靠性和访问速度,以下是分布式存储架构的几个关键组成部分:

(1)存储节点:负责存储和管理数据。

(2)数据副本:为了保证数据可靠性,每个对象存储多个副本。

对象存储服务采用的存储机制是什么类型,深入解析对象存储服务,存储机制及其工作原理

(3)元数据管理:负责存储对象的元数据,如对象名称、类型、大小、创建时间等。

(4)负载均衡:根据访问压力,将请求分配到不同的存储节点。

2、数据存储流程

(1)上传数据:用户将数据上传到对象存储服务,系统为数据生成唯一标识符。

(2)存储数据:将数据存储到存储节点,并生成多个数据副本。

(3)元数据存储:将对象的元数据存储到元数据管理系统中。

(4)访问数据:用户通过API接口访问数据,系统根据请求找到相应的存储节点,返回数据。

3、数据复制和同步

为了保证数据可靠性,对象存储服务采用数据复制和同步机制,以下是数据复制和同步的几个关键步骤:

(1)数据复制:将数据存储到多个存储节点,形成多个数据副本。

(2)数据同步:当存储节点发生故障时,系统自动将数据从其他节点同步到故障节点。

(3)数据校验:定期对数据进行校验,确保数据一致性。

对象存储服务采用的存储机制是什么类型,深入解析对象存储服务,存储机制及其工作原理

对象存储服务优势

1、高可靠性

通过分布式存储架构和数据复制机制,对象存储服务具有较高的数据可靠性。

2、高性能

采用负载均衡和缓存技术,提高数据访问速度。

3、低成本

采用分布式存储架构,降低存储成本。

4、易于使用

提供简单的API接口,方便用户操作。

5、高扩展性

支持水平扩展,满足海量数据存储需求。

对象存储服务作为一种新兴的存储技术,具有高可靠性、高性能、低成本、易于使用等特点,通过分布式存储架构、数据复制和同步机制,实现海量数据的存储和管理,随着互联网技术的不断发展,对象存储服务将在未来发挥越来越重要的作用。

黑狐家游戏

发表评论

最新文章